Singapore Exchange Rejects Aussino Application

Because of an investor on the US sanction list, Singapore Exchange rejects Aussino share IPO. In a surprise decision, the Singapore Exchange rejected the application for the Sing$70 million or US$57 million reverse takeover deal of Aussino Group.

Telecom Ltd Acquires Revera Ltd

Telecom Ltd purchases Revera Ltd for NZ$96.5 million. Telecom New Zealand Ltd announced last Monday that it is acquiring Revera Ltd, a privately owned IT infrastructure and data center based in Auckland, NZ.

Telenor ASA purchases HTO's Bulgarian mobile unit. The biggest telecommunications operator in the Nordic region Telenor ASA has entered into an agreement to purchase Hellenic Telecommunications Organization SA's Bulgarian mobile subsidirary for Eur717 million or US$934 million.

BFA earmarks Eur275 million shares for Bankia. Reuters reported today that BFA, the Spanish state owned banking group, has committed that it will spend up to Eur275 million or US$358 million on the acquisition of new shares to be released by subsidiary lender Bankia by May of this year.
